Definition of Profit Margin

Definition of Profit Margin Profit margin is a fundamental metric in business finance and accounting that quantifies the profitability of a company relative to its revenue. Advantages and Disadvantages of Capitalist Economy

Advantages and Disadvantages of a Capitalist Economy Capitalism, characterized by private ownership of the means of production and the creation of goods or services for profit, is a dominant economic system in many parts of the world. Cost-Benefit Analysis

Cost-Benefit Analysis: A Comprehensive Overview Cost-Benefit Analysis (CBA) is a systematic approach to evaluating the economic pros and cons of different decisions, projects, or policies. This method aims to help decision-makers assess whether a certain action will maximize overall benefits or result in unwarranted costs.
